Schoenebeck Christian wrote:
``Moving a file to another directory becomes a bit of a
challenge, since we
now have a mapping that spans a single directory. So some means of
linking these PDDB`s must be developed. I could actually envision a
repository structure where EVERY file is stored in the same flat
directory.''
My thougts. The only thing I'm concerned about is that the ext2 file system
would have it's problems with this, as it's performance slows down with a
high amount of files in a single directory. But that's a system specific
problem and guess this doesn't account to the new ext3 file system.
As far as I recall, doesn't ext3 use the same layout on disk, plus
journalling info? ReiserFS may be better - wasn't it designed for
different usage scenarios? http://www.namesys.com/ for more info..
Perhaps it would be better to store all the files in a database, rather
than many-files-in-one-directory. Hashing the files across a tree of
directories would be better, although what could you use as the hash
key? You couldn't use file name, since in a rename/move, that'd change..?
